Post subject: | Hiking Straps and Buckle |
Hi Just bought some new hiking straps and buckles for the bravo but for the life of me I can't seem to thread them so they won't pull out! Any ideas or help would be greatly appreciated. |

Author: | Spyeder [ Tue Jun 06, 2017 9:38 am ] |
Post subject: | Re: Hiking Straps and Buckle |
Have you been back-threading for the last step? It is the same thing done in climbing harnesses and belts to prevent slipping. You know, like an old, three-post belt (boy scout style). |
Author: | pHREDD [ Wed Jun 07, 2017 12:16 am ] |
Post subject: | Re: Hiking Straps and Buckle |
Brilliant! Thanks Spyeder. I've doubled over one end and then back threaded both ends on the buckle! I now can't budge it! (What a relief!) |
